The Serenity of the Dead

Hezekiah Wakeley's last letter to Nathaniel was written in February 1838. He wrote that he had been suffering from sleeplessness, but now his nights have become easier of late. The Sexton has settled into a new role at the church and spends most of his unoccupied time digging graves for dead people. "I am never as truly satisfied as when I am in my slumber and insensible to the world," writes Wakeley.
